Personal Review: GRAN GATSBY, EL (Contemporanea)
(Spanish Edition) by F. Scott Fitzgerald
In the Great Gatsby, F Scott Fitzgerald created a wonder. He described a
world and a fiend we can all relate to, that of frustrated and not fully
requitted love, and he described it with all the beauty that anybody using
the English language could muster. His message was the we are all
fighting against the tide of time, which beats us back ever more forcefully
with the progressing years, and yet we all feel that our youth, our elixir,
our perfect moment and strength of Orient is within our grasp. Gatsby
was a man who had lost once, and yet felt the compulsion to fight again,
for the ultimate prize that would revoke his past defeat. A simple and
bewilderingly focused passion that in the end destroyed the man as only it
could. That was Gatsby's only goal, but in stripping his life down to such
basics, and in essence, seeking to negate the past, Gatsby found he was
fighting against the viscious tide of time. Read this book for the narrative,
if you like. Read it for the beautiful Jazz Age description if you like also.
But read it most of all for the moments in it whose beauty surpasses all
contemporarys'. Find the green light.
